Job Description

At SLS Red Sea, a Waiter/Server plays a key role in delivering an elevated and dynamic dining experience that is bold, playful, and personal. Reporting to the F&B Supervisor, this position is responsible for providing attentive, high-quality food and beverage service while supporting the overall operation of the outlet. The Waiter/Server ensures smooth day-to-day service, contributes to guest satisfaction, and helps drive revenue through upselling and expert product knowledge.

Key Responsibilities
  • Provide consistent, professional service of all food and beverage offerings in accordance with hotel SOPs and brand standards.
  • Ensure a smooth flow of daily operations and support the Supervisor in meeting service quality and guest satisfaction goals.
  • Act as a liaison between the kitchen and the service team to ensure timely and accurate order delivery.
  • Maintain a strong presence on the floor, anticipating guest needs and ensuring a warm, engaging, and efficient dining experience.
  • Confidently handle guest inquiries, comments, or complaints with a solutions-focused and proactive approach.
  • Maintain cleanliness, hygiene, and presentation standards across the dining area and service stations.
  • Use POS systems (e.g., Micros) efficiently for order-taking and billing processes; handle cash and credit transactions in line with company procedures.
  • Monitor product quality and communicate any inconsistencies to the Supervisor or Chef.
  • Consistently apply upselling techniques to enhance the guest experience and maximize revenue.
  • Assist in daily and weekly inventory checks and ensure proper storage and stock levels of operating equipment and supplies.
  • Support the bar operations when required.
  • Attend pre-shift briefings, team meetings, and training sessions as required.
  • Deliver highly personalized service to all guests, including VIPs, ensuring each guest feels recognized and valued.
